§ 30.2A. Salaries
A. For fiscal year 2021 and each fiscal year thereafter, except as otherwise provided by the Board on Judicial Compensation after the effective date of this act,1 the following judicial officers shall receive compensation for their services, payable monthly as follows:
1. The Presiding Judge of the Court of Civil Appeals shall receive an annual salary of One Hundred Fifty-five Thousand Four Hundred Fifty-nine Dollars ($155,459.00); and
2. A Judge of the Court of Civil Appeals shall receive an annual salary of One Hundred Fifty-two Thousand Six Hundred Thirty-two Dollars ($152,632.00).
B. Any increase in salary provided for in subsection A of this section must be paid from existing available funds.

Credits

Laws 1997, c. 384, § 5, eff. Jan. 1, 1998; Laws 2000, c. 37, § 4, eff. Jan. 1, 2001; Laws 2004, c. 499, § 5, eff. July 1, 2005; Laws 2015, c. 399, § 2; Laws 2021, c. 341, § 2, emerg. eff. April 28, 2021.
